> Hi all , I finally got educated enough to figure some things out with these 
> 1.6 blocks. (Thanks for the pics, Shawn!) I have an older, early 1.6 CR block 
> and it definately is lacking the bosses in the casting where the oil squirters 
> go. HOWEVER, much to my surprise, the CS block I have from a vanagon DOES have 
> the correct casting. The flats would need to be machined and the holes 
> drilled for the squirters but it does appear to be doable, if marginally impractical 
> due to cost of machining and the squirters. If I had to guess I would say the 
> ME blocks most likely have the correct castings as well, but I'm not sure.

Doug,

Do you have a line on the TD pistons, or do you plan on trying to modify NA ones? (Is 
this safe...?). I've seen TD shortblocks on Ebay for around $1000 US, and since the TD 
pistons are about half that, I'd be thinking pretty hard about all the other costs to get an 
NA block turned into a TD. I bought my complete 1.6TD engine with all accessories and 
a complete exhaust system for $1200 CDN. That was 8 years ago, and they may be 
harder to find now in good running condition, but maybe you can find one in good 
rebuildable condition (that doesn't need new pistons). My $1200 engine went 300k kms 
and is still within specs for a rebuild with standard pistons.
Not to rain on things, but I'd hate to see you sink $600-800 into it when you might find a 
real TD for not much more...--
